CLASS DESCRIPTIONS
REGULAR CLASSES
Levels I, II, III and IV
Yoga North offers four levels of Iyengar yoga classes from Level I (introductry, beginner level), Level II and III (intermediate), to Level IV (an advanced class for senior students and teachers).
In all levels the practice will include some classes that are of a more restorative nature and others that are more active and faster paced.
Progression through the levels tends to be highly individual and requires a consultation with a teacher. In addition, there are several sepcialized classes offered throughout the year with a defined focus or for specific needs or groups.
- In Level I, about 25 yoga postures are introduced which provide the foundation for a well-rounded yoga practice. Through these foundational postures, students learn how to practice yoga in the Iyengar method correctly and safely and develop the strength, stamina, flexibility and body awareness required to proceed to the next level. Students learn to be familiar with the props used for various postures. Each subsequent level builds on the previous one by adding more postures and deepening the yoga experience.
- Level II students become comfortable with a longer shoulderstand, as well as prepare for and begin headstands.
- Students progressing to Level III must have a solid 3-5 minute shoulderstand. Among other postures, headstand is practiced regularly with increasingly longer holds.
- Level IV involves longer, sustained holding of the postures, more advanced postures, and headstands of 5 minutes or more.
FLOW
The Flow class is based on Surya Namaskarasana or Sun Salutations. In this approach, the sequence flows from one pose to another, creating a rhythmic, athletic practice in a shorter class (1 1/4 hours). Suitable for levels 2 to 4.
Men's Class
This Class is for new and returning men who want to explore how yoga can address fitness, injury, stiffness and stress.
Seniors
This is a gentler yoga class where seniors, 65 years plus, can develop greater flexibility, balance, strength, and much more ease in their bodies. Practiced correctly, yoga can help ease the discomfort of arthritis and the general aches and pains of aging. If you enjoy physical activity in the company of your peers, this class is for you.

Advanced Class
The "advanced class" is for students who are interested in exploring more challenging and difficult asanas as well as deepening their understanding and experience of all the asana. Some of the things to expect in the advanced class are: longer timings in the inversions and their variations; more emphasis on balancing asanas; an emphasis on approaching and doing the completed classical versions of the asanas; and, completion of more intense practice sequences that challenge strength and stamina as well as mobility.
To qualify for attendance, you must be an Iyengar Yoga student for a minimum of 5 years, be at a level 3 or 4 class, be able to do headstand and shoulder stand independently and have a working knowledge of the basic asanas of all the major classes of asanas€“ i.e. standing, sitting, forward extension, backward extension, twists, and abdominal poses€“ and if you have problems or injuries, you should know how to work with them reasonably well in a classroom/workshop situation.
